Transaction acae633c64e5da3da22b67e8cb0fb43950947c2f21a43757288b5cd3bbb4257d
1 Input
1 Output
-
acae633c64e5da3da22b67e8cb0fb43950947c2f21a43757288b5cd3bbb4257d:0
- value
- 50007651
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76b7522366e1badebb17ded1343cadd182b37785 OP_EQUAL
- address
- 3CWjGY2z3cYqYgvyPwp7pa2kpDCp1tWdKS